French martini mocktail made with Ms Sans Vodka Alternative Make Mine A Martini and garnished with raspberries

Popular throughout the 1980's and 1990's, the first French Martini was made in the early 1980's at a New York City bar. In 1996 it was featured on the cocktail menu at McNally's Balthazar in SoHo. Originally made using Vodka and raspberry or blackberry liqueur, it remains a popular drink at top bars around the world today. 

INGREDIENTS

3 parts Ms Sans Vodka Alternative Make Mine A Martini 
1 part Raspberry Syrup
1 part Pineapple Juice

METHOD
  1. Shake the ingredients in a cocktail shaker with ice.
  2. Pour into a classic martini glass
  3. Garnish with fresh raspberries or a wedge of pineapple
